A Ubisoft employee's LinkedIn profile hints at the company's next "AAAA" title. Let's delve into the details surrounding this potentially massive project.

Ubisoft's Reported "AAAA" Project

Following in Skull and Bones' Wake

Ubisoft's Next

A recent X (formerly Twitter) post by Timur222 highlights a Junior Sound Designer at Ubisoft Indian Studios' LinkedIn profile. The profile, according to the post, indicates involvement in both AAA and AAAA game projects. The employee's description explicitly states responsibility for "Sound design, SFX and foley for the unannounced AAA and AAAA game projects." This suggests a significant, high-budget undertaking is underway.

Ubisoft's Next

While specifics remain undisclosed, the mention of "AAAA" is significant. This classification, coined by Ubisoft CEO Yves Guillemot for Skull and Bones, signifies a game of immense scale and budget. Despite Skull and Bones' AAAA designation, its reception has been mixed, raising questions about this new project.

This new revelation reaffirms Ubisoft's ambition to continue producing "quadruple-A" games, implying future titles may mirror Skull and Bones' production values and scope.
